The Adventures of Prince Achmed is a 1926 German animated fairytale film, written and directed by Lotte Reiniger. Since two earlier Quirino Cristiani films are lost, it remains the oldest surviving animated feature film. The plot is based on elements from several One Thousand and One Nights stories, such as "Aladdin," "Ahmed and Paribanou", and "The Ebony Horse".
